The positivist research paradigm and design:____.

A. assume that reality is subjective.

B. generate numerical or statistical data.

C. employ qualitative research (e.g., interviews).

D. take a context-sensitive approach.

Answers

The positivist research paradigm and design generate numerical or statistical data. (option b).

The positivist research paradigm and design emphasize the use of objective and measurable data. Positivism is based on the belief that there is an objective reality that can be studied and understood through scientific methods. This approach seeks to generate numerical or statistical data to test hypotheses, establish causal relationships, and make generalizations about the population under study.

Positivist researchers aim to collect empirical evidence through controlled experiments, surveys, or observations, and analyze the data using statistical analysis to draw conclusions. This approach contrasts with subjective or qualitative research methods that focus on understanding meaning, subjective experiences, and contextual interpretations. The correct option is b.

what is the range of the possible values of r2? 0 to 1 any positive numerical value -1 to 1 0 to 100

Answers

The range of the possible values of r^2 is 0 to 1. It represents the proportion of the dependent variable’s variance that can be explained by the independent variable(s).


The coefficient of determination, often denoted as r^2, measures the proportion of the dependent variable’s variance that can be explained by the independent variable(s) in a statistical model. The value of r^2 ranges from 0 to 1.
A value of 0 for r^2 indicates that the independent variable(s) does not explain any of the variance in the dependent variable. On the other hand, a value of 1 implies that the independent variable(s) fully explain the observed variance in the dependent variable.
Therefore, the range of the possible values of r^2 is 0 to 1. Any positive numerical value within this range indicates a degree of explanatory power, while values outside this range are not meaningful in the context of r^2. It serves as a useful tool for assessing the strength of a statistical relationship and the predictive ability of a model.
